Spring Boot Made Simple: Build Modern Java Web Apps and REST APIs with Java is a practical, beginner-friendly guide designed to take you from the fundamentals of Java to building fully functional, production-ready Spring Boot applications. Whether you are a complete beginner in backend development or a Java programmer looking to transition into modern web development, this book gives you a clear, structured, and hands-on path to mastering Spring Boot without confusion or unnecessary complexity.
This book breaks down complex backend concepts into simple, digestible lessons while guiding you through real-world application development. You will learn how to build RESTful APIs, connect applications to databases, manage user input, implement validation, handle errors, and structure scalable backend systems using industry best practices. Each concept is explained in a practical way, ensuring you not only understand how things work but also why they are used in real software systems.
As you progress, you will move beyond theory and start building real applications, including CRUD systems, authentication workflows, responsive web integrations, and secure backend services. You will also learn how to package your applications using Maven, deploy them to cloud platforms, connect to production databases, and prepare your applications for real-world usage.
Unlike overly technical references that overwhelm beginners, this book focuses on clarity, simplicity, and practical implementation. Every chapter is designed to build your confidence step by step, helping you think like a professional backend engineer.
By the end of this book, you will be able to design, build, and deploy modern Java-based backend applications using Spring Boot with confidence, clarity, and real-world skill.
If you are ready to move from basic Java knowledge to professional backend development, this book is your complete roadmap